Storage Click Boards

Mikroe Storage Click Boards add storage to various applications and designs. Mikroe Click Boards are based around the mikroBUS™ interface standard and easily add incredible system capabilities. The devices are ideal for applications requiring storage like SRAM, EEPROM, microSD, etc.  

EEPROM 7 Click

Mikroe EEPROM 7 Click is a high-density memory solution that features the Microchip 25CSM04 4-Mbit SPI Serial EEPROM with a 128-bit serial number and enhanced write protection mode. The 25CSM04 has a compatible SPI serial interface and is internally organized as 2,048 pages of 256 bytes each. The EEPROM includes a security register with a 128-bit unique serial number and a 256-byte (2048-bit) user-programmable lockable ID page, built-in ECC, and a configurable write protection scheme for all bytes.
